Anti-inflammatory effects of two platelet-rich gel supernatants in an in vitro system of ligament desmitis
SUMMARY Background. There is not even a knowledge of what is the perfect concentration of cells that should be present in platelet-rich plasma (PRP) to induce an effect for treatment of desmitis. Our aims were determining the temporal effects (48 and 96 h) of leukocyte-concentrated platelet-rich gel supernatant (Lc-PRGS) and leukocyte-reduced platelet-rich gel supernatant (Lr-PRGS) … Continued
